This is a work-related qualification for students taking their first steps into employment or those already in employment and seeking career development opportunities. The purpose of Pearson BTEC Higher Nationals in Construction and the Built Environment is to develop students as professional self-reflecting individuals able to meet the demands of employers in the construction sector and adapt to a constantly changing world. Students will gain a wide range of sector knowledge tied to practical skills gained in research self-study directed study and workplace scenarios. Students completing the course will be able to demonstrate a sound knowledge of the basic concepts of construction and the built environment with a focus on civil engineering. They will be able to communicate accurately and appropriately and they will have the qualities needed for employment that requires some degree of personal responsibility. They will have developed a range of transferable skills to ensure effective team working independent initiatives organisational competence and problem-solving strategies. They will be adaptable and flexible in their approach to construction and the built environment show resilience under pressure and meet challenging targets within a given resource.Units delivered over two years of part-time study for this qualification are: Individual Project Construction Technology Science & Materials Construction Practice & Management Construction Information (Drawing Detailing Specification) Mathematics for Construction Civil Engineering Technology Principles of Structural Design
